Founded in 1826, C.S. Osborne & Co. has a rich history of providing high-quality tools for harness makers and saddlers. Charles Samuel Osborne and his brother Henry spearheaded the company, catering to the demand for horse-related crafts in Newark. The company’s legacy continued through Charles’s son, Jasper, and later Walter Dodd Osborne, propelling it to become the largest harness-tool manufacturer globally by the 1880s. The acquisition of H.F. Osborne and Wm. Johnson, Inc. in 1958 marked a significant milestone, solidifying the company’s growth and innovation. As C.S. Osborne & Co. approaches its 200th anniversary in 2026, it remains a beacon of excellence in tool manufacturing.

Fun Facts About Stevens County, KS

  • County Seat: Hugoton
  • Year Established: 1886
  • Formed from: Formed from Seward County
  • Etymology: Thaddeus Stevens, U.S. Representative from Pennsylvania who was a leader of Reconstruction politics
  • Time Zone: America/Chicago
  • Population: 5756
  • Land Area Sq Km: 1886
  • Land Area Sq Mi: 728
  • Density: 7.9
